GE reportedly sells Crotonville as part of its corporate restructuring, marking a shift in corporate training paradigms.
GE Aerospace (NYSE:GE) was launched as an independent company following the spin-off of GE Vernova Inc. (NYSE:GEV).
For decades, the GE management academy at Crotonville, overlooking the Hudson River, hosted workshops and strategy sessions.
